What does that mean? I can see 47 because he's (as far as I know) the 47th US president but why 86?

63

u/are-you-lost- 10d ago

In restaurant lingo, 86 is a verb meaning to remove something from the menu options, usually a dish that we are out of the ingredients to make.

86 47 means to remove president 47
